Output ddb9183232ba5aeb3eb0a62dc52cfe61aa4f352a4b023756207bf2a1eb6e70ea:3

value
162024383
script pubkey
OP_0 OP_PUSHBYTES_20 9ed2a8076b026f92e16e5f5a4c7d0b8600fa1d79
address
bc1qnmf2spmtqfhe9ctwtadyclgtscq058tejnr0ru
transaction
ddb9183232ba5aeb3eb0a62dc52cfe61aa4f352a4b023756207bf2a1eb6e70ea